| 1 | #ifndef MARS_MCalibrationConfig
|
|---|
| 2 | #define MARS_MCalibrationConfig
|
|---|
| 3 |
|
|---|
| 4 | /////////////////////////////////////////////////////////////////////////////
|
|---|
| 5 | //
|
|---|
| 6 | // MCalibrationConfig
|
|---|
| 7 | //
|
|---|
| 8 | // Contains all configuration data of the Calibration
|
|---|
| 9 | //
|
|---|
| 10 | // This file is only TEMPORARY. It values will go into the DATABASE
|
|---|
| 11 | //
|
|---|
| 12 | /////////////////////////////////////////////////////////////////////////////
|
|---|
| 13 |
|
|---|
| 14 | // The conversion factor between High Gain and Low Gain
|
|---|
| 15 | const Float_t gkConversionHiLo = 10.;
|
|---|
| 16 | const Float_t gkConversionHiLoError = 2.5;
|
|---|
| 17 |
|
|---|
| 18 | // ----- BLIND PIXEL ----------------------//
|
|---|
| 19 |
|
|---|
| 20 | // Average QE of Blind Pixel (three colours)
|
|---|
| 21 | const Float_t gkCalibrationBlindPixelQEGreen = 0.154;
|
|---|
| 22 | const Float_t gkCalibrationBlindPixelQEBlue = 0.226;
|
|---|
| 23 | const Float_t gkCalibrationBlindPixelQEUV = 0.247;
|
|---|
| 24 | const Float_t gkCalibrationBlindPixelQECT1 = 0.247;
|
|---|
| 25 |
|
|---|
| 26 | // Average QE Error of Blind Pixel (three colours)
|
|---|
| 27 | const Float_t gkCalibrationBlindPixelQEGreenError = 0.015;
|
|---|
| 28 | const Float_t gkCalibrationBlindPixelQEBlueError = 0.02;
|
|---|
| 29 | const Float_t gkCalibrationBlindPixelQEUVError = 0.02;
|
|---|
| 30 | const Float_t gkCalibrationBlindPixelQECT1Error = 0.02;
|
|---|
| 31 |
|
|---|
| 32 | // Attenuation factor Blind Pixel (three colours)
|
|---|
| 33 | const Float_t gkCalibrationBlindPixelAttGreen = 1.97;
|
|---|
| 34 | const Float_t gkCalibrationBlindPixelAttBlue = 1.96;
|
|---|
| 35 | const Float_t gkCalibrationBlindPixelAttUV = 1.95;
|
|---|
| 36 | const Float_t gkCalibrationBlindPixelAttCT1 = 1.95;
|
|---|
| 37 |
|
|---|
| 38 | const Float_t gkCalibrationOutervsInnerPixelArea = 4.0;
|
|---|
| 39 | const Float_t gkCalibrationOutervsInnerPixelAreaError = 0.2;
|
|---|
| 40 |
|
|---|
| 41 | // ----- PIN DIODE ------------------------//
|
|---|
| 42 |
|
|---|
| 43 | //
|
|---|
| 44 | // Area of Inner Pixel w.r.t. PIN Diode (which is 1 cm²)
|
|---|
| 45 | //
|
|---|
| 46 | // Distance of PIN Diode to pulser D1: 1.5 +- 0.3 m
|
|---|
| 47 | // Distance of Inner Pixel to pulser D2: 18.0 +- 0.5 m
|
|---|
| 48 | //
|
|---|
| 49 | //
|
|---|
| 50 | // D1*D1
|
|---|
| 51 | // conversion C = ------ = 0.0069
|
|---|
| 52 | // D2*D2
|
|---|
| 53 | //
|
|---|
| 54 | // Delta C / C = 2 * Sqrt( (Delta D1/D1)² + (Delta D2/D2)² )
|
|---|
| 55 | // Delta C / C = 0.4
|
|---|
| 56 | //
|
|---|
| 57 | // C = 0.007 +- 0.003
|
|---|
| 58 | //
|
|---|
| 59 | const Float_t gkCalibrationFluxCameravsPINDiode = 0.007;
|
|---|
| 60 | const Float_t gkCalibrationFluxCameravsPINDiodeError = 0.003;
|
|---|
| 61 |
|
|---|
| 62 | //
|
|---|
| 63 | // Average QE of the PIN Diode
|
|---|
| 64 | //
|
|---|
| 65 | const Float_t gkCalibrationPINDiodeQEGreen = -1.0;
|
|---|
| 66 | const Float_t gkCalibrationPINDiodeQEBlue = -1.0;
|
|---|
| 67 | const Float_t gkCalibrationPINDiodeQEUV = -1.0;
|
|---|
| 68 | const Float_t gkCalibrationPINDiodeQECT1 = -1.0;
|
|---|
| 69 |
|
|---|
| 70 | //
|
|---|
| 71 | // Average QE of the PIN Diode
|
|---|
| 72 | //
|
|---|
| 73 | const Float_t gkCalibrationPINDiodeQEGreenError = -1.0;
|
|---|
| 74 | const Float_t gkCalibrationPINDiodeQEBlueError = -1.0;
|
|---|
| 75 | const Float_t gkCalibrationPINDiodeQEUVError = -1.0;
|
|---|
| 76 | const Float_t gkCalibrationPINDiodeQECT1Error = -1.0;
|
|---|
| 77 |
|
|---|
| 78 | #endif /* MARS_MCalibrationConfig */
|
|---|